                    • Thomas Braun
                      Thomas Braun Most Active @avunculo last edited by

                      @avunculo

                      Auch du fährst da einen Mix aus zwei Releases in den sources.lists
                      Das gibt früher oder später Kopfschmerzen. Eher früher.

                      Ist hier auch ein Problem:
                      https://forum.iobroker.net/topic/54420/iobroker-mit-120-auslastung-und-no-connection-to-database/3

                      Räum die Quellen auf.

                                • Thomas Braun
                                  Thomas Braun Most Active @avunculo last edited by

                                  @avunculo

                                  Versuch mal

                                  iobroker stop
                                  cd /opt/iobroker
                                  sudo -H -u iobroker npm install iobroker.js-controller
                                  
                                  A 1 Reply Last reply Reply Quote 0
                                  • A
                                    avunculo @Thomas Braun last edited by avunculo

                                    @thomas-braun said in iobroker startet nach Stromausfall nicht mehr:

                                                                                                                                                                                                            sudo -H -u iobroker npm install iobroker.js-controller                                            
                                    

                                    VIELEN DANK! 🙂 🙂 Zugriff auf meinen iobroker habe ich schonmal!!!
